Whispers of the Deep: The Mermaid's Vow

In the heart of the Eastern Sea, where the waves whispered secrets to the moon, lay the kingdom of the Sirens. Long before the world was shaped by the hands of men, the Sirens had been guardians of the sea's soul, their voices the heartbeat of the ocean's lifeblood. But a great curse had befallen them, a curse so ancient that even the oldest of the Sirens could not recall its origin. The sea's soul had been stolen, leaving the waters lifeless and the creatures of the deep in despair.

Amara, the daughter of the Queen of the Sirens, was a mermaid of unparalleled beauty and power. Her voice could calm the wildest storm and her touch could heal the deepest wounds. Yet, as she grew, she felt the weight of her destiny pressing upon her. Her mother, the Queen, had been the one to impart the ancient lore, the tales of the sea's soul and the promise of redemption.

"The sea's soul is not a thing of flesh and bone," her mother had once said, her eyes reflecting the depth of the ocean. "It is the essence of the sea itself, the life force that binds us all. To reclaim it, you must make a vow, a vow that will change the course of our existence."

Amara had listened, her heart heavy with the knowledge of her calling. She knew that her vow would be the key to saving her people, but it would also come at a great cost. She would be bound to the sea, her fate forever entwined with the life and death of the ocean's soul.

One stormy night, as the moon hung low and the waves crashed against the shore, Amara stood before the ancient temple of the Sirens. The temple, built of coral and sea shells, had stood for centuries, its secrets hidden from the world above. Inside, she found an ancient book, its pages yellowed with age and inked in a language long forgotten.

The book spoke of the curse, a spell woven by a dark sorcerer who sought to drain the sea's power for his own gain. The only way to break the curse was to find the sorcerer's lair, deep within the heart of the sea, and to defeat him with the power of the sea's soul.

Amara knew that her journey would be fraught with peril. The sorcerer's lair was a place of darkness and despair, where the shadows whispered lies and the creatures of the deep lay in wait. But she was determined. She would make her vow, and she would fulfill her destiny.

With her heart set, Amara stepped into the temple's heart, her eyes closing as she whispered her vow to the sea. "I, Amara, daughter of the Queen of the Sirens, vow to reclaim the sea's soul and restore balance to the ocean. I will journey to the depths of the sea and face the darkness within, for the sake of my people and the life of the sea."

As she spoke, the temple seemed to vibrate with energy, and a surge of power flowed through her veins. She felt the weight of the sea's soul upon her, a weight that was both heavy and exhilarating. She knew that from this moment on, her life would be forever changed.

The next morning, Amara set sail on her father's ancient ship, the Siren's Whisper. The ship was as old as the Sirens themselves, its sails woven from the finest silk and its hull carved from the heart of a great whale. As she set sail, the wind picked up, and the ship moved swiftly through the waves.

Amara's journey was long and arduous. She faced numerous challenges, from the cunning of the sea creatures that sought to hinder her path to the treacherous waters that threatened to engulf her. But she pressed on, driven by her vow and her love for her people.

One day, as she navigated through a treacherous coral reef, she felt a sudden jolt. The ship had run aground, and she was forced to swim to the surface. As she emerged, she saw the sorcerer's lair, a dark cave that seemed to reach into the very heart of the sea.

With a deep breath, Amara dived into the cave, her heart pounding with fear and determination. The darkness was thick, and she could barely see her hand in front of her. But she pressed on, her mind focused on her vow.

As she reached the heart of the cave, she found the sorcerer, a twisted creature of darkness and decay. He had been using the stolen sea's soul to sustain his existence, but now he faced his end.

"Your time is up, sorcerer," Amara declared, her voice echoing through the cave. "The sea's soul will be returned to its rightful place, and balance will be restored."

With a roar, the sorcerer lunged at her, but Amara was ready. She raised her hand, and a surge of energy flowed from her, enveloping the sorcerer in a blinding light. He was consumed by the light, and as he vanished, so too did the darkness that had plagued the sea.

With the sorcerer defeated, Amara reached out and reclaimed the sea's soul. It flowed into her, and she felt a surge of power unlike anything she had ever known. She knew that her people would be saved, and the sea would once again be vibrant and full of life.

As she made her way back to the surface, she could feel the sea's soul pulsing within her. She knew that her journey was far from over, but she was ready to face whatever challenges lay ahead. The sea had chosen her, and she would fulfill her vow.

Back at the Siren's temple, Amara made her way to the sacred chamber where she had made her vow. She placed the sea's soul back into its resting place, and the temple seemed to come alive with energy. The Sirens gathered around her, their eyes filled with awe and gratitude.

"The sea's soul has been returned," Amara announced. "The curse is broken, and the sea will once again be a place of wonder and beauty."

The Sirens cheered, their voices rising above the sound of the waves. Amara knew that her journey had only just begun, but she was ready to face the future with courage and determination. The sea's soul had been saved, and with it, the hope of a new beginning.
